Teaching Method and Techniques
As a tutor, my approach is student-centered, focusing on understanding each student's unique learning style and adapting my methods accordingly. I employ a mix of the following techniques:
Active Learning: Encouraging students to engage with the material through problem-solving, discussions, and hands-on activities.
Socratic Method: Asking guiding questions to help students think critically and arrive at solutions on their own.
Visualization: Using diagrams, charts, and visual aids to explain complex concepts, especially in subjects like chemistry and physics.
Analogies and Real-World Examples: Relating abstract concepts to real-world situations to make them more relatable and easier to understand.
Incremental Learning: Breaking down complex topics into smaller, manageable parts and building upon them step-by-step.
A Typical Lesson Plan
Introduction (5-10 minutes):
Brief review of the previous lesson.
Outline of the day's objectives and topics to be covered.
Core Instruction (20-30 minutes):
Introduction of new concepts using visual aids and real-world examples.
Interactive explanations and guided practice problems.
Practice and Application (15-20 minutes):
Students work on practice problems individually or in small groups.
Immediate feedback and assistance provided as needed.
Review and Recap (10-15 minutes):
Discussion of common mistakes and misconceptions.
Summary of key points covered in the lesson.
Q&A session to address any lingering questions.
Homework Assignment:
Practice problems or projects to reinforce the day's lessons.
Encouragement to reach out with any questions before the next session.
